US trade officials finalized steep tariff levels on most solar cells from Southeast Asia, a key step toward wrapping up a year-old trade case in which American manufacturers accused Chinese companies of flooding the market with unfairly cheap goods. The petitioner group, the American Alliance for Solar Manufacturing Trade Committee, accused big Chinese solar panel makers with factories in Malaysia, Cambodia, Thailand and Vietnam of shipping panels priced below their cost of production and of receiving unfair subsidies that make American goods uncompetitive. Combined dumping and countervailing duties on Jinko Solar products from Malaysia were among the lowest at 41.56%. Rival Trina Solar’s products from its operations in Thailand face tariffs of 375.19%.Products from Cambodia would face duties of more than 3,500% because its producers elected not to cooperate with the US probe.
“These are very strong results,” Tim Brightbill, an attorney for the US manufacturing group, said on a call with reporters. “We are confident that they will address the unfair trade practices of the Chinese-owned companies in these four countries, which have been injuring the US solar manufacturing industry for far too long.”
Critics of the effort, including the Solar Energy Industries Association trade group, have said tariffs would harm US solar producers because they would raise prices on the imported cells that are assembled into panels by American factories.

A newly revealed document shows Gov. Ron DeSantis' administration diverted $10 million in Medicaid dollars to a charity controlled by his wife.
Lawyers working with the state drafted a settlement agreement that said Florida’s largest Medicaid contractor, Centene, had overbilled taxpayers more than $67 million for medications, according to a copy of that document obtained by the Miami Herald/Times. But instead of returning all of that to state and federal taxpayers, the administration sent $10 million to the Hope Florida Foundation. Representatives for the firm told the newspaper that a donation to Hope Florida Foundation had not been discussed in their settlement talks, and the firm learned of the settlement through media reports "The money was then sent to two nonprofit organizations that aren’t required to report how they spend their funds," the Herald/Times reported. "Those 'dark money' groups later gave $8.5 million to a political committee overseen by DeSantis’ chief of staff in a series of transactions that some Republican lawmakers believe was illegal. "How Medicaid is allocated, which pays for healthcare services for the poor, is highly regulated."The draft agreement contradicts statements by the governor and other state officials claiming the money was a charitable contribution by Centene, which DeSantis said "was in addition to what they [the state] were getting.”

Although the US has the world's largest Christian population, President Donald Trump – who counts evangelicals among his most fervent supporters – deemed it necessary to sign an Executive Order creating the task force to counter "persecution" of the faithful.His cabinet contains several members with links to Christian nationalists, including Vice President JD Vance and Secretary of Defense Pete Hegseth.In memos seen by AFP, government employees have been told to provide examples of anti-Christian bias they have witnessed at work – providing dates and locations as well as the names of those involved.An email sent out Tuesday by Veterans Affairs Secretary Doug Collins asked staff to inform the department of any "informal policies, procedures, or unofficial understandings hostile to Christian views. Bondi said her task force would work with faith-based organizations and state-level bureaucracies to identify and "fix" abuses by the federal government."
The Washington-based liberal Interfaith Alliance lobby group has condemned Trump's focus on anti-Christian bias, arguing that the task force would aid organizations looking to circumvent anti-discrimination laws."There is no evidence of widespread anti-Christian bias in the United States, and perpetuating this myth is deeply offensive to the actual Christian persecution that happens in other countries around the world," it said in a statement after Trump created the task force.
